Output 54e1e9374bf3222276d268a6c2ec419a489c882564e2c66089a0b57e12b87149:21

value
713699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55ea90f79205bccde665d8a6bcf3103344b2411e OP_EQUAL
address
39XJMoMZKpLZmk4UaYKfPFZMXzx99oTpTy
transaction
54e1e9374bf3222276d268a6c2ec419a489c882564e2c66089a0b57e12b87149
spent
true